What is a Bedside Cot?
A bedside cot, also known as a co-sleeper or sleeper, is designed to attach safely to an adult bed, allowing a moms and dad to be near their infant while still supplying a different sleeping space. This plan promotes easier nursing, convenience throughout nighttime awakenings, and a sense of security for both moms and dad and baby.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)Q: Is a bedside cot safe for my baby?
A: Yes, as long as the cot complies with safety requirements and is set up properly, it can be a safe option for your baby. Constantly ensure there are no gaps in between the cot and bed where the baby could get stuck.
Q: How do I understand if a bedside cot is right for me?
A: Consider your sleeping practices, space at home, and how often you expect to be nursing during the night. If you choose having the baby close without sharing the exact same bed, a bedside cot is an exceptional choice.
